Because 1979 Koons has manufactured get the job done in just collection.[26] His early get the job done was in the shape of conceptual sculpture, an example of that is The Pre-New, a number of domestic objects connected to light-weight fixtures, leading to Unusual new configurations. Another instance is The brand new, a number of vacuum-cleaners, normally picked for brand name names that appealed towards the artist like the enduring Hoover, which he experienced mounted in illuminated Perspex packing containers. Koons first exhibited these pieces within the window of the New Museum in New York in 1980.

During the early nineties, Koons was sued a number of situations for copyright infringement above his use of economic and artistic source material in his pieces. The situations were all upheld and provided the prominent Koons vs Rogers wherein Art Rogers, knowledgeable photographer, agreed an from courtroom settlement with Koons after it was demonstrated that Koons' sculpture String of Puppies (1988) within the Banality series was a duplicate with the Rogers' photograph Puppies (1985).
